Understanding Powder Brows: Sand, Mist, and Ombre





Powder brows are a breakthrough in semi-permanent makeup, offering a versatile technique that's kinder to the skin and suitable for all skin types. Powder brows are great for all skin types including oily skin or skin with larger pores where Microblading is not suited for those skin types. Utilizing a machine for application, powder brows provide a soft, diffused look that resembles the effect of brow powder makeup.


This method is notably less invasive than microblading, making it an appealing choice for those with sensitive or mature skin. There are three main types of powder brows: Sand, Mist, and Powder Ombre, each designed to cater to various aesthetic preferences.


Sand Brows


Sand brows boast a unique gradient effect, with a darker, defined base that subtly lightens towards the top. This technique creates a bold yet natural appearance, perfect for those seeking a standout look without compromising on subtlety.


Mist Brows


Mist brows are known for their exceptionally natural appearance, thanks to a soft, indistinct outline. This style is ideal for achieving symmetry, particularly for those with uneven brows, offering a subtle enhancement that blends seamlessly with your natural features.


Powder Ombre Brows


For those who favor definition, Powder Ombre brows offer a striking contrast, with tails that are darkest, gradually fading towards the front. This method is ideal for individuals looking for a bold, makeup-like effect.


Key Advantages of Powder Brows


Enhanced Color Retention


One significant advantage of powder brows over traditional methods is their superior color retention. This attribute means that the brows not only look more vibrant initially but also maintain their color clarity for longer periods, reducing the need for frequent touch-ups.


Versatility with Microblading


Powder brows can be combined with microblading to create a look that offers both natural hair strokes and a more defined brow body. This combination is perfect for those who wish for the texture and dimension of natural brows along with the polished appearance of a defined outline.


Gentle on the Skin


Compared to microblading, powder brows are less traumatic to the skin, making them a preferable option for those with mature or sensitive skin. The technique is especially beneficial in its mistier or fluffier variants, which are even gentler and reduce the risk of irritation.

Powder brows stand out as a sophisticated and adaptable choice in semi-permanent eyebrow styling. Whether you're drawn to the natural elegance of Mist brows, the bold definition of Powder Ombre, or the balanced beauty of Sand brows, this technique offers a customized approach to achieving your ideal eyebrow look, with added benefits like enhanced color retention and gentleness on the skin.
